Transaction 839f369106a1eab56af8f1b4105ee9a36a0cf33395e709f0e1a09f8a10b0a617

4 Input
2 Outputs
  • 839f369106a1eab56af8f1b4105ee9a36a0cf33395e709f0e1a09f8a10b0a617:0
  • value  112268150
    address  3EGwvuvdQugR4oggnHfVGwEg9DZxiZgLyW
  • 839f369106a1eab56af8f1b4105ee9a36a0cf33395e709f0e1a09f8a10b0a617:1
  • value  145483023
    address  14zMBGtXopjDpr4CJ1fztto9GXPacW6ETd